Reliance Foundation’s
approach to Education
interventions
Reliance Foundation pursues a range of primary, secondary, and tertiary Education initiatives. Its primary Education
initiatives strive to develop teacher skills and infrastructure to expand access and improve the quality of learning.
It is establishing a network of high-quality secondary schools with new programmes to enable virtual learning and
remedial education. It is also building world-class tertiary education institutions and giving scholarships to worthy
students to help unearth talent and develop future leaders.
Building world-class tertiary
education institutions
Jio Institute – embarking on a journey of excellence
Jio Institute is a nonprofit, interdisciplinary higher education institution designed to foster innovation and
nurture talent for India and the world. The Institute’s focus on programme design, research, innovation, and
entrepreneurship is driven by its high-powered academic leadership, comprised of eminent figures from academia,
industry, policy think-tanks, and the social sector. Its 52 acres campus at Ulwe, Navi Mumbai is a digitally-enabled
green space designed for collaboration.
New courses
Jio Institute has commenced two new one-year Postgraduate (PG) Programmes in Artificial Intelligence and Data
Science (AI & DS) and Digital Media and Marketing Communications (DM & MC) in 2022. Jio Institute also plans to
develop postgraduate courses in Journalism, Public Health and Sports Management in the near future.
